Sentimental JourneyMatsumoto Iyo

A song sung by a 16-year-old girl, whose pure feelings come through straight and clear.
Released in October 1981, this debut work is a masterpiece of idol pop crafted by hitmakers Reiko Yukawa and Kyohei Tsutsumi.
Chosen as the tie-in track for Lotte’s “Ghana Chocolate” commercial, the song brought Iyo Matsumoto to wide public attention, reaching No.
9 on the Oricon charts and selling 343,000 copies.
Its lyrics, which candidly express the authentic emotions of a teenager, resonate across generations and remain etched in many people’s hearts even today.
Hum it with friends who remember those days at reunions or karaoke, and the nostalgia is sure to come flooding back.
ultra-strongestChou Tokimeki♡Sendenbu

A self-assured, love-filled track delivered by Cho Tokimeki♡Sendenbu.
Featured on the album “Tokimeki Rulebook,” this pop number portrays the relationship between idols and their fans.
The lyrics, packed with the desire to be called “cute” and heartfelt gratitude to fans, leave a strong impression.
Paired with a catchy melody, it captivates listeners.
It’s recommended not only for their fans but also for anyone who needs a boost—this song will lift your spirits!
Single‑minded Cinderella!CUTIE STREET

CUTIE STREET, the hottest idol group right now.
Unlike the trendy idol groups that mainly feature K-pop influences, their classic, moe-filled orthodox style really stands out.
Their song “Single-minded Cinderella!” is a gem with a bright, poppy vibe.
From the feel of the track, you might think it’s high, but surprisingly the vocal range is narrow, and there are no sustained notes in the upper mid to high range.
It doesn’t demand fundamental vocal technique, so it’s a song that’s easy for any woman to sing.
Restartmameshiba no taigun

An idol group that sprang from TBS’s variety show “Wednesday’s Downtown.” The producer even includes that Kuro-chan from Yasuda Dai Circus.
The members’ names—like Aika the Spy and Hanae Monster—are boldly unique, heavily influenced by their agency WACK.
Their debut song “Re-Start” is, quite literally, a playful, humorous anthem about “starting over” in life.
With its slightly quirky lyrics, it’s a sure-fire crowd-pleaser.
Since they’re a WACK-affiliated idol group, they’re also recommended for fans of BiSH.
Earphone Riotshiritsu ebisu chūgaku

A revitalized Shiritsu Ebisu Chugaku, now joined by new members Kokona Sakuragi, Yuno Kokubo, and Nodoka Kazami—winners of the nationwide audition—deliver a breezy youth anthem of encouragement.
The lyrics are a delight, prompting you to reflect on questions like “What does it mean to be yourself?” and “What are your own words?” When you sing it at karaoke, give it all the energy you’ve got to keep up with Ebichu! If you’re singing with a group, don’t forget to assign parts in advance.
Be sure to trade off the calls like “Hey!” and “Say!” yourselves.
And don’t miss the music video—those light-blue and white outfits are wonderful!
InfluencerNogizaka 46

Here is a song by Nogizaka46 produced by Yasushi Akimoto.
It was released in 2017, with Mai Shiraishi and Nanase Nishino serving as the double centers.
The arrangement has a Spanish flair that makes the members of Nogizaka46 feel even more passionate.
Matching that fiery vibe, the choreography is one of the fastest in the group’s catalog, and the members reportedly struggled with muscle soreness while mastering it.
It seems like a track that would really get the crowd going if you sing and dance to it at karaoke.
